Intel ha lanzado la primera beta pública de un componente de su Intel Parallel Studio: el Intel Parallel Composer. La compañía, que es tan responsable como otras en los esfuerzos que se están llevando a cabo para aunar la informática paralela con la creación de procesadores multinúcleo, ha lanzado el Intel Parallel Composer en su versión Beta, mientras los otros componentes –Intel Parallel Advisor, Intel Parallel Inspector e Intel Parallel Amplifier- serán lanzados como beta en 2009, según James Reinders, director de marketing de los productos de desarrollo de software de Intel.
Reinders ha explicado a esta publicación que Intel Parallel Composer es una serie unificada de compiladores y bibliotecas para desarrolladores de Microsoft Visual Studio C++ que acelera y simplifica los hilos de ejecución para mejorar la productividad.
Mejora la capacidad de Microsoft Visual Studio para soportar todo el espectro de expresión paralela y se aprovecha de las últimas versiones de Intel de compiladores y bibliotecas para paralelismo.
Intel Parallel Composer incluye tanto compiladores de 32 como de 64 bit y da soporte a estándares como Threading Building Blocks (TBB) y OpenMP. OpenMP es una API que soporta programación multiproceso de memoria compartida en C/C++ y Fortran.
“Pienso que hay cuatro cosas que ofrecemos a los desarrolladores para que se adapten mejor al paralelismo: soporte para estándares, extensiones de depurador, funciones de comprobación estática y extensiones para paralelismo”, comenta Reinders.
Reinders añadió que Intel soporta OpenMP 3.0, la última versión del estándar. “Damos soporte completo a este estándar, lo que supone una gran ayuda ya que el lenguaje C no fue escrito para soportar la programación en paralelo”.
Intel también está dando soporte a extensiones para el estándar C++. “Los responsables del estándar C++ han estado añadiendo varias cosas al borrador –conocidas como C++0x- para soportar el paralelismo”, explica Reinders.
Intel está apoyando las funciones lambda, valarray paralelo y entrada/salida asíncrona. La compañía apoya la I/O asíncrona a través del soporte a la especificación Portable Operating Sistemas Interface (POSIX). Y la autovectorización, la autoparalelización, el spawn y las bibliotecas son algunas de las funciones adicionales que ofrece con Intel Parallel Composer.
Además, Intel ofrece extensiones de depurador paralelo que añaden funcionalidad al depurador de Microsoft, como la función Parallel Lint. Parallel Lint permite realizar diagnósticos de archivos fuente para eliminar bugs, violaciones del límite y corrupción de memoria.
Page: 1 2
Se puede implementar en plataformas de Kubernetes, el edge, centros de datos y servicios como…
La empresa adquirida está especializada en software para impulsar las cargas de trabajo de inferencia…
Gartner cree que 4 de cada 10 centros de datos de IA se enfrentarán a…
Esta herramienta ayuda a automatizar la detección de problemas y a reparar entornos de Kubernetes.
Entre sus características se encuentran una pantalla de 12 pulgadas en formato 3:2 y un…
La compañía lanza, por un lado, los modelos AFF A20, A30 y A50 y, por…